Frequently Asked Questions
Fits most Mikuni VM, PF, BS series carbs (e.g., VM26, VM30, VM34-VM40). Check your carb markings.
This is the high speed (main) jet for the main circuit, not pilot.
Often bought individually for fine-tuning existing setups or as part of a full jet kit.
Proper sizing can optimize air/fuel ratio for better performance at wide-open throttle.
#220 main jet size.
Installation Guide
Tools Required
- Small flathead screwdriver
- Jet wrench or needle nose pliers
Pro Tips
- Remove carb float bowl fully. Note original jet size. Clean all parts with carb cleaner. Test in short bursts after install.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Dropping jet into carb body (use magnet tool)
- Not cleaning needle jet before install
Comparison vs Stock/OEM
OEM jets are often smaller; this #220 is larger for modified/exhaust/air filter setups
Improvements
- Better fueling for high RPM/power
- Eliminates lean conditions
- Improved throttle response
Considerations
- Must match intake/exhaust mods; may require dyno tuning for optimal AFR
